Nisus and euryalus are a pair of friends and lovers serving under aeneas in the aeneid, the augustan epic by virgil. As the trojans guard the walls of their fortress, nisus, a trojan, tells his young friend euryalus about his eagerness to do some brave act. On the walls of the trojan settlement, nisus sees a way to get through the rutulian camp and inform aeneas of the situation. He appears to have no sense of justice or of what is morally acceptable as he flaunts the death of nisus and euryalus by marching amongst the people with their heads stuck atop spears.
